Researchers at San Diego State University have received millions of dollars in funding that's helped them develop an artificial intelligence robot that they…

"My role is to provide insights, suggestions and support to help healthcare professionals make more informed decisions, freeing them up to focus on the aspects of care that require a human touch," Pepper, the AI robot, said24/7 San Diego news stream: Watch NBC 7 free wherever you are

"It's like, 'Oh, let's get some facts. Let's play Jeopardy. Let's beat people at chess," Elkins said."We're in this era now where AI is really focused on emotions."Despite not being able to experience emotions, Pepper — and her fellow robot, Bernard — can recognize them in people. Elkins says that ability makes AI the perfect tool to help people with mental health issues, especially children with bipolar disorder.

To move from reactionary psychiatry to preemptive, Elkins says the center has partnered with area hospitals like Sharp, looking to use the technology to diagnose diseases and disorders, which sometimes can be hard to do. Microphones, as well as light detection and ranging sensors, help Pepper sense the world and people around her. She also has an iPad as a display.
